Quick Coherence Technique by HeartMath
A self-guided practice to create heart coherence and connect you to calm, inner-wisdom, and genuine empowerment:
1. Focus your attention on the area around your heart or the center of your chest area.
2. Imagine your breath is flowing in and out of your heart or your chest area, breathing a little slower and deeper than usual. You may follow this simple video with your gaze and adjust your breathing to this rhythm. Putting your attention on the heart area helps you center and get coherent.
3. As you continue heart-focused breathing, make a sincere attempt to experience a regenerative feeling, such as appreciation or care for someone or something in your life. Try to re-experience the feeling you have for someone you love, a pet, a special place, an accomplishment, or simply focus on a feeling of calm and ease.
4. Notice the shift in your emotional state and energy and maintain it along with your relaxed breath for the duration of this video.

Why We Round the Corners in Neurographica

As we draw in Neurographica, our lines naturally intersect—creating angles and sharp corners. These angles represent internal conflict in the subconscious perception: the places where thoughts, emotions, or beliefs contradict one another. They are like mental knots—signs of resistance, confusion, or energetic stagnation.
By gently rounding these corners, we send a powerful signal to the brain:
“This doesn’t have to stay stuck.”
We show the nervous system that what once felt like a conflict can become a point of flow, integration, and harmony.
Rounding softens the internal experience. It tells your mind, “You’re safe. There’s a way through.”
In nature, energy always seeks the path of least resistance. Through this simple act of rounding corners, we align our minds with that natural wisdom—creating space for clarity, ease, and emotional regulation to emerge.
The Heart of NeuroGraphica: The Neurographic Line
Every Neurographic drawing contains one unmistakable element: the Neurographic Line (or NeuroLine). This distinctive line is what transforms a simple drawing into a powerful tool for neurological and emotional transformation.
The Two Key Rules of the Neurographic Line:
1. The line never repeats itself: each movement is unique, just as each moment of our life experience is unique.
2. The line takes us where we don't expect to go: it follows an intuitive movement rather than patterns based on previous experiences, opening us to new possibilities.
When drawing, allow your hand to move with curiosity rather than certainty. This creates neural pathways that break habitual thinking patterns and invite new perspectives.
